Nobel Prize medal depicting its founder Alfred Nobel

The Nobel Prizes are a set of five prizes awarded yearly since 1901 for physics, chemistry, physiology/medicine, literature, and peace.

Physiology or Medicine Prize

António Egas Moniz received the Nobel Prize for inventing the lobotomy. The prize officials have never rescinded this award.[1]
